Centennial Library

Search Metlakatla Alaska

Centennial Library, serving an area of 1,380 residents, has a collection of 8,400 books and periodicals; in addition, there are 360 video items, such as DVDs and VHS tapes. Internet terminals are available for use by the general public.

Staffing consists of one employee, plus volunteers. Annual expenditures on the library collection total $3,900. Patrons make 1,380 visits annually, and check out materials 1,760 times. Twenty-eight percent of all check-outs are children's materials.

Location: 4th & Milton Street, Metlakatla Alaska 99926 Telephone 907-886-6332
